Django Training

by Besant Technologies Claim Listing

Django is a free open-source Python web framework that mainly follows the MVC architecture pattern. It is designed and maintained by the Django software foundation. The main goal of the Django python framework is to create database-driven and complex websites.

Price : Enquire Now

Contact the Institutes

Fill this form

Advertisement

Besant Technologies Logo

img Duration

Please Enquire

Course Details

The Django course in Bangalore will help you work on real-life projects and case studies to gain hands-on experience on all the core concepts of Python Django framework.

The Django Course content that we provide for the learners should be course-specific because it is important for the learners to get the latest updates of a particular course.

In order to help students gain knowledge of all the concepts that are essential, we need to provide a good course curriculum. While designing the course syllabus we take various measures to make sure that it is clear and precise.

The development of course content must be done frequently to update the latest content information. If the modules in the course content are clear then the students will be in a position to set a time limit for each module to learn. Providing the best course content for the students will make us feel proud by seeing the satisfaction levels in learners.

Django is a free open-source Python web framework that mainly follows the MVC architecture pattern. It is designed and maintained by the Django software foundation. The main goal of the Django python framework is to create database-driven and complex websites.

It is considered as the best framework among all the Python frameworks. It enables the rapid development of the pragmatic design. It is very easy to install and also it enables one to build and develop secure websites.

This popular Python framework design is very effective and easily understandable for all users. A framework is a collection of a set of components that improves the website’s efficiency and speed.

 

Syllabus:

  • Section I- Installation and Setup – Duration:03 Hours
  • Learning Objective: In this Section, We are going to Discuss the Basic Overview and how to install and Create Django Application and Project, Project Structure
  • Topics:
  • 1. Django Overview
  • 2. Django Installation
  • 3. Creating a Project
  • 4. Usage of Project in depth Discussion
  • 5. Creating an Application
  • 6. Understanding Folder Structure
  • 7. Creating a Hello World Page
  • Hands-On: Installation and Basic Hello World in Django Web Page
  • Section II- Database and Views – Duration: 10 Hours
  • Learning Objective: Creating a Models and Views in the Application, in this Module going Advance in Django to Understand about how to Write Views and How to write Database connection with Django.
  • Topics:
  • 1. Requests and Responses
  • 2. Models and Admin Page
  • 3. Creating a Super User
  • 4. Views and Templates
  • Hands-On: 1. Creating a Blog Application
  • Section-III – Static Files and Forms – Duration:07 Hours
  • Learning Objective: In this section, we are discussing how to handle a CSS, JavaScript Files and How to handle the Forms
  • Topics:
  • 1. Forms and Generic Views
  • 2. Static Files and Setting File Update
  • 3. Customizing the Admin Page
  • Hands-On: 1. Creating a Shop Application
  • Section-IV – API and Security – Duration: 05 Hours
  • Learning Objective: In this section, we will be discussing about handling the API and Security Services
  • Topics:
  • 1. What is API?
  • 2. Overview about REST API
  • 3. Implementing in Django
  • 4. Creating a Login-Signup Page
  • Hands-On: 1. Creating a Question and Answer Application
  • Section-V: Creating a Final Project Duration: 15 Hours
  • Learning Objective: All the above-discussed topics will be implemented here to create a complete Project.
  • Topics:
  • 1. Project Specs
  • 2. Writing a Database
  • 3. Models, Designing and Migrations
  • 4. View and Display
  • 5. Search Options
  • 6. Accounts and Authentication
  • 7. Contact Enquiries
  • 8. Dynamic Page Handling
  • 9. Django Deployment
  • Hands-On: 1. Creating a Real Estate Application with Client and Server, Like a Magic Bricks where peoples can post their Property and Viewers can View and Contact a. Bootstrap as Frontend b. MySQL as Database.
  • Velachery Branch

    Plot No. 119, No.8, 11th Main Rd, Vijaya Nagar, Velachery, Chennai

Check out more Django courses in India

TechiZone Logo

Web Development Using PHP / ASP.NET

Web Development Using PHP/ASP.NET course is offered by TechiZone. At TechiZone Computer Institute, we are working hard to impart practical skills to students that are always in demand by employers in various sectors and help them get Jobs.

by TechiZone [Claim Listing ]
Keywords Technologies Logo

Web Technologies

This web technology program a wide range of tools and techniques used in the process of communication between different types of devices over the internet. Some of the vital applications covered here include HTML, CSS, JavaScript, Bootstrap, and Jquery. 

by Keywords Technologies
Keywords Technologies Logo

PHP, Laravel, Ajax, Code Igniter Application Expert

This training will teach you about web application design such as HTML, Javascript, Bootstrap, CSS and Advanced Javascripts, PHP and Ajax, WordPress, JQuery, etc.

by Keywords Technologies
NobleProg (India) Logo

Drupal 7 For Developers Training Course

Online or onsite, instructor-led live Drupal training courses demonstrate through interactive discussion and hands-on practice the fundamentals and applications of Drupal. Drupal training is available as "online live training" or "onsite live training".

by NobleProg (India) [Claim Listing ]
K.S. Computer Education Center Logo

Visual Basic

Visual Basic Course is Offered by K.S. Computer Education Center

by K.S. Computer Education Center [Claim Listing ]

© 2024 coursetakers.com All Rights Reserved. Terms and Conditions of use | Privacy Policy